Understanding the Science
Sansevieria trifasciata uses crassulacean acid metabolism (CAM) photosynthesis, a unique adaptation to arid native habitats that lets it conserve water by opening its stomata (leaf pores) only at night to take in carbon dioxide. The plant stores this CO₂ as malic acid, then uses it to make sugars for growth during the day when its stomata are closed to prevent water loss (Pamonpol et al, 2020). This is why snake plants are so drought tolerant, but they still need a minimum of 500 lux of light to convert stored malic acid into usable sugars for growth. In low-light spaces, photosynthesis slows dramatically, so the plant uses far less water than it would in brighter conditions — this is why overwatering is the number one cause of death for snake plants in north-facing apartments, as excess water sits in soil and rots roots before the plant can use it.
Step-by-Step Low-Light Growth Boost Remedy
Follow these exact steps to get lush, steady growth even in 500 lux light:
- Do a pre-care health check first: Squeeze lower leaves to confirm they are firm (soft leaves signal overwatering), inspect leaf color for yellowing or browning, and count new growth from the last 6 months (healthy low-light snake plants put out 2-3 new leaves per year). This baseline lets you track progress over 3 months.
- Relocate to the optimal light spot: Move your plant to within 2 feet of your north-facing window, and use a free phone lux meter app to confirm light levels are between 500 and 2500 lux. Avoid direct sun, which can scorch leaves during rare midday summer north-facing light exposure (NC State Extension, 2026).
- Water only when soil is completely dry: Stick your finger 3 inches into the soil, or use a cheap moisture meter, to confirm moisture levels are below 20% before watering. For a standard 6-inch pot, use exactly 120ml of room-temperature filtered water, poured directly onto the soil (avoid wetting the leaf crown to prevent rot). - Fertilize sparingly twice per year: In early spring and mid-summer, add 1/8 tsp of 10-10-10 balanced liquid fertilizer diluted to 1/4 strength to your watering can. Over-fertilizing is far more harmful than under-fertilizing in low light, as the plant cannot use extra nutrients when photosynthesis is limited.
- Adjust for low humidity: If your HVAC drops humidity below 30% in winter, mist leaves once per week with filtered water, or place a pebble tray under the pot (no expensive humidifier required).
- Track progress: Mark your calendar for your next watering, and take a photo of your plant once per month. You should see new, thick green growth within 6 months of adjusting your routine.

Common Mistakes to Avoid
-
Mistake: Overwatering on a fixed schedule without checking soil moisture first.
What happens: Root rot, mushy yellow snake plant leaves low light, and eventual plant death, as slow photosynthesis in dim spaces means the plant uses 50% less water than it would in bright indirect light.
Instead: Only water when the top 3 inches of soil are completely dry, using 120ml per 6-inch pot. If you notice soft yellow lower leaves, stop watering for 4 full weeks before checking soil moisture again. -
Mistake: Placing your snake plant more than 3 feet away from your north-facing window.
What happens: Stunted growth, thin floppy leaves, and no new shoots, as light levels drop below the 500 lux minimum required for photosynthesis (Pamonpol et al, 2020).
Instead: Keep the plant within 2 feet of the window, and confirm light levels are above 500 lux with a free phone app. No grow light is needed if you hit this threshold. -
Mistake: Over-fertilizing to compensate for low light levels.
What happens: Brown leaf tip burn, salt buildup in the soil, and root damage, as the plant cannot use excess nutrients when photosynthesis is limited.
Instead: Fertilize only twice per year at 1/4 strength. If you notice tip burn, flush the soil with 3x the pot volume of filtered water to remove excess salt, and pause fertilizer for 6 months. -
Mistake: Exposing your snake plant to cold drafts from window AC or heating units.
What happens: Brown crispy leaf edges, leaf drop, and slowed growth, as Sansevieria trifasciata is native to tropical West Africa and cannot tolerate temperatures below 50°F (10°C) (NC State Extension, 2026).
Instead: Move the plant 1 foot away from draft sources, and use a cheap stick-on thermometer near the pot to confirm temperatures stay between 60 and 85°F (16-29°C). -
Mistake: Using unamended potting soil that retains too much moisture.
What happens: Root rot even if you follow correct watering schedules, as dense soil holds water for weeks longer than the well-draining mix snake plants prefer.
Instead: Use a mix of 50% standard potting mix, 40% perlite, and 10% orchid bark for fast drainage, no special tools required for mixing.
Troubleshooting Guide
Yellow or Mushy Lower Leaves
Symptom: Soft, yellow, water-soaked leaves near the base of the plant, often with a sour smell coming from the soil.
Likely cause: Overwatering in low light, leading to root rot.
Fix:
- Stop watering immediately, and leave the plant in its spot near the north window for 4 full weeks to let the soil dry completely.
- Gently remove the plant from its pot after 4 weeks to inspect roots: if roots are brown and mushy, trim away rotten roots and repot in fresh well-draining soil mix.
- Adjust your future watering schedule to only water when the top 3 inches of soil are 100% dry.
Thin, Pale New Leaves
Symptom: New growth is floppy, lighter green than mature leaves, and smaller than existing leaves, with no new shoots emerging for 12+ months.
Likely cause: Light levels are below the 500 lux minimum required for steady growth, the top cause of snake plant stunted growth fix for low-light apartments.
Fix:
- Move the plant to within 1 foot of your north-facing window, and use a lux meter app to confirm light levels are above 1000 lux during daytime hours.
- Avoid placing any furniture or decor between the plant and the window that blocks ambient light.
- You should see thicker, darker new growth within 3 months of relocating.
Brown Crispy Leaf Tips
Symptom: Dry, brown tips on the ends of mature leaves, with no mushy spots or yellowing on the rest of the leaf.
Likely cause: Fluoride or chlorine in tap water, or humidity levels below 30% from year-round HVAC use.
Fix:
- Switch to filtered or rainwater for all future watering to avoid mineral buildup.
- Mist leaves once per week with filtered water if your indoor humidity is consistently below 30%.
- If tips are already brown, you can trim them with sharp scissors, cutting at an angle to match the natural leaf shape for a seamless look.
Brown Leaf Edges
Symptom: Dry, brown edges along the sides of mature leaves, often paired with leaf drop in severe cases.
Likely cause: Exposure to cold drafts from window AC or heating units, or consistent temperatures below 55°F (13°C).
Fix:
- Move the plant 1 foot away from all draft sources, including window sills, AC units, and heating vents.
- Use a stick-on thermometer near the pot to confirm temperatures stay between 60 and 85°F (16-29°C) year round.
- Avoid placing the plant near exterior doors that are opened frequently in winter.

Is Sansevieria trifasciata safe for my cat that chews plants?
No, Sansevieria trifasciata is mildly toxic to cats and dogs if ingested, according to the ASPCA (2026). The plant contains saponins that can cause vomiting, diarrhea, and lethargy if eaten in large quantities. If you have a pet that chews plants, place your snake plant on a high shelf out of reach, or choose a pet-safe low-light houseplant like a spider plant instead.
